Rev. William George Dicks, 73, of Washington, died Tuesday, November 25, 2008, in Sarasota Memorial Hospital, in Sarasota, Florida, following a brief illness.
He was born May 26, 1935, in Washington, a son of Clarence Herbert and Helen Marie King Dicks.
Rev. Dicks was a minister at First Baptist Church of Carmichaels for five years, and Grace Baptist Church in Grindstone for five years.
Rev. Dicks worked at Washington Steel, as a millwright, for twenty-eight years. He was also a Pennsylvania State Constable.
He was member of the Southern Baptist Convention, as a church planner; and was a member of the North Franklin Volunteer Fire Department.
Rev. Dicks enjoyed spending time with his family, traveling in his R.V., singing, and going out to dinner.
On July 16, 1962, he married Judith Ann Bedillion, who survives.
Also surviving are a son, William George (Charlynne) Dicks II, of Brownsville; a daughter, Lori Ann (Don Head) Davis, of Leland, IL; a brother, Francis (Jean) Dicks; five sisters, Helen Jean Kelley, Clara (Cecil) Anderson, Alberta Lunn, and Mary Kania, all of Washington, and Margaret “Peg” (Robert) McVehil,of Beaver Falls; and two grandchildren, Paul William and David Lee Head.
Deceased are an infant daughter, Michele; a brother, Clarence (Bud) Dicks; and two brothers, Herbert, Lewis and a sister, Jane, who died in childhood.
